The Samsung Energy Storage System (ESS) is designed to store excess energy generated from renewable sources such as solar panels and wind turbines. This stored energy can then be used during peak demand hours or when renewable sources are not producing energy. By implementing an ESS, users can enjoy energy independence, reduce their reliance on the grid, and decrease their overall energy expenditure.

Integrating Samsung's Energy Storage System into your energy strategy is a process that requires careful planning and consideration:
Start by evaluating your current energy consumption patterns. Understand how much energy you use daily, identifying peak usage hours and opportunities for improvement.
Samsung's ESS systems come in varying capacities. Based on your energy assessment, select a model that aligns with your energy demands. A professional installer can help you determine the optimal size.
If you plan to use a solar or wind energy system in tandem with the ESS, ensure these installations are completed first. This will allow the energy captured to be stored effectively.
To maximize efficiency, consider hiring a certified professional for the installation of your Samsung ESS. Proper setup and integration with existing systems are crucial for optimal performance.
Samsung's Energy Storage System has been implemented in various scenarios, showcasing its versatility:
Many homeowners are adapting Samsung's ESS to supplement their solar power systems. By storing excess energy generated during the day, families can use clean energy during the night or cloudy days, decreasing their dependence on the utility grid.
Businesses that operate during peak energy cost times benefit greatly from the integration of an ESS. By storing energy during off-peak hours and utilizing it when costs are highest, businesses can see significant savings on their energy bills.
Large-scale facilities can utilize Samsung's ESS for energy management and reliability. With a significant energy storage system in place, factories can maintain operations during outages or fluctuations in energy supply.
